Drawn from the archives of Hermes, here is a collection of enchanting stories and profiles that trace the odyssey of the family business founded by Thierry Hermes in 1837.

Author Luc Charbin brings to life the voices of the saddlers, sales assistants, window-dressers, silversmiths, and gardeners of Hermes across several generations, accompanied by the distinctive drawings of Alice Charbin.

A leather-clad wheelbarrow to store the Duchess of Windsor's many gloves, a capricious apple tree, an extraordinary museum, an iconic bag, and a 40-year-old diary in the spotlight-these are among the characters and objects that tell the story of Hermes: Straight from the Horse's Mouth.
